DB Schenker Rail puts sparkling wine on the rail for DHL

DHL FoodServices covers long-distance routes from Spain to Germany with Railports on the railway:

DHL FoodServices GmbH has shifted part of the shipments for Freixenet, producer of wine and sparkling wine, on the route between Spain and Germany from road to railway. With the support of DB Schenker Rail 6.900 paletts of wine and sparkling wine were transported from the end of December 2010 until the end of May this year, which means more than 3.1 million bottles.

DB Schenker Rail is in charge of the complete transport. The pallets are transported by truck from the filling plant in Villafranca del Penedes near Barcelona to Perpignan, 200 kilometres away in southern France.This is where DB Schenker Railport carries out the reloading to rail wagons. Afterwards the journey is continued on the rail to the logistics centre in Darmstadt, from where it is forwarded by truck to the supply and distribution warehouse in Bingen.

„Our innovative and European-wide door-to-door logistics based on DB Schenker Railports closes gaps on the first and last kilometres", says Karsten Sachsenröder, Sales Manager of DB Schenker Rail. Dieter Gerfer, CEO DHL FoodServices, adds: "DB Schenker Rail offers our customer Freixenet the option of shifting truck transportations systematically to the railway."
